How to Help with Homework

  • Let your child know that homework is important and valuable.
  • Set a regular time each day for homework, allowing some time to unwind after school before getting started.
  • Be sure your child has all essentials, such as paper, books, school notebooks and pencils.
  • Help your child get organized by providing folders for papers and a calendar and/or assignment book.
  • Have a quiet, clean and well-lit place to study, with a comfortable chair. Keep all schoolwork there.
  • Discourage distractions, including TV during study time. Allow study breaks at intervals.
  • Be available to answer questions or help quiz your child, but keep homework as his or her responsibility to complete.
  • Spot check homework when it's completed, but don't correct assignments unless the teacher has asked you to.
  • Read any comments the teacher has made on returned assignments.

  • Of a homework problem arises, contact the teacher for clarification.

    REMEMBER: Praise your child for homework done to the best of his or her ability.
